Rio Tinto signs Palantir for data platform deal

Enterprise data software company Palantir Technologies Inc said it signed a multi-year enterprise agreement for its Foundry product with Rio Tinto.

Financial details were not disclosed.

Palantir's software will integrate raw data from a multitude of sources within Rio Tinto into a representation of critical mining operations, allowing the miner to make decisions and take action using a single source of truth that combines operational and transactional data.

The data resource will be available to Rio Tinto's frontline and office-based workers.

"This partnership is an important step in our digital transformation; enabling fast-paced, forward-looking decision making across our operations leading to improved results in safety, cost and production," said Rio Tinto's chief information officer Fay Cranmer in a statement.

The new multi-year partnership with Rio Tinto builds on a number of successful data integration projects explored in 2020 across various business units including: transforming the miner's Borates operations to a digital business across the value chain, connecting people with data in Rio Tinto's underground operations; and assisting the company during the COVID-19 pandemic.

"This is a significant industry partnership for us", says Palantir chief operating officer Shyam Sankar, COO of Palantir. "Our Foundry Platform has been used extensively to accelerate delivery and optimise value chains across a number of market sectors where safety matters."
